Today is the 15th anniversary of the release of Beyoncé's single, "Ring the Alarm." The video paid homage to a scene from the 1992 film "Basic Instinct." Teyana Taylor, who was 15 years old at the time, was credited as a choreographer.
Did you know Cicely Tyson was the first Black actress to wear her natural hair on television? She appeared on the 60's show "East Side/West Side" with a cropped afro.
Soul legend Betty Wright has passed away at 66, her niece has confirmed. Wright was behind classic tracks like “Clean Up Woman,” “No Pain (No Gain,)” and “Tonight is the Night” and was known for her effortless whistle register notes. She will be missed. 🕊🌹
These albums turn 20 this year: Aaliyah's 'Aaliyah,' 'Survivor' by Destiny's Child, 'Miss E... So Addictive' by Missy Elliott and Alicia Keys' 'Songs in A Minor.'

This is the first time in history that the Golden Globes for both Best Actor and Best Actress in a Motion Picture (Drama) have been awarded to Black actors. Congratulations to Chadwick Boseman and Andra Day 🏆 (📸:
